Freddie Mercury, we found out in May 2025, has a woman claiming to be his daughter. A new biography titled Love, Freddie by Lesley-Ann Jones unveiled a long-held secret about Queen frontman Freddie Mercury: he fathered a daughter in 1976 during an affair with the wife of a close friend.

The woman, referred to as “B,” is now 48 years old and works as a medical professional in Europe. She claims to have had a close and loving relationship with Mercury until he died in 1991.

Her existence was known only to Freddie Mercury’s inner circle, including his bandmates, family, and long-time confidante Mary Austin. According to the biography, Mercury began writing personal journals upon learning of the pregnancy, eventually compiling 17 volumes that he entrusted to “B” before his passing. These journals, chronicling his life from childhood in Zanzibar to his final days, form the basis of the biography. “B” shared their contents to allow Mercury to “speak” for himself and correct misconceptions about his private life. 

Biographer Lesley-Ann Jones was initially skeptical and convinced of “B’s authenticity after three years of collaboration, noting that she never sought publicity or financial gain. The biography is set to be released on September 5, 2025.

Freddie Mercury’s 17 personal journals, entrusted to his daughter “B,” offer an intimate glimpse into the legendary Queen frontman’s life. These diaries span from June 20, 1976, shortly after Mercury learned of B’s conception, to July 31, 1991, just months before his death. They chronicle his journey from childhood in Zanzibar, through his school days in India, to his rise to fame in London. 

The journals delve into Freddie Mercury’s thoughts, memories, and feelings, providing insights into his experiences and relationships. They also shed light on his private struggles, including his battle with AIDS. In a letter in the biography Love, Freddie, B explains her decision to share these diaries. She said:

After more than three decades of lies, speculation and distortion, it is time to let Freddie speak… He entrusted his collection of private notebooks to me, his only child and his next of kin.
